The trend in finished garages is soaring, especially in Colorado, where the space takes a beating from weather extremes. Derek adds, “While ‘man caves’ are definitely part of the trend, most of our projects are about functionality and organization for the whole family. We help families create organized storage for bikes, skis, snowboards, golf clubs and all the holiday decorations. A well-designed garage reduces stress—it eliminates the constant cycle of clutter and clean-up.”
Beyond curb appeal, modern insulated doors can create up to a 20-degree temperature difference inside the garage, enhancing comfort and improving the home’s overall energy efficiency. A finished, well-lit garage is also a strong differentiator in the real estate market.
“When most homes have stained concrete and unfinished walls, a clean, insulated, well-lit garage feels like a true extension of the home. It delivers very real, practical and emotional benefits that families can enjoy every single day – and when they finally sell, they can make their money back and then some,” Derek shares.

Investing in the garage is increasingly recognized as a financially smart move. According to Derek, industry studies consistently show that projects like garage door replacement rank among the highest for return on investment (ROI) — often exceeding 200%. “The garage door can represent nearly a third of the front of the home’s façade. Upgrading it dramatically improves curb appeal almost instantly,” Derek explains.
